Hi, I am having zoom hybrid meeting with 10 f-to-f participants and 20 online. We are also using simultaneous translation with two languages. Since all the f-to-f participant cannot connect to internet and use zoom, we would like to use RF transmitter connected to the host's computer's USB port in order to transmit translated audio to the room participants headsets (they are using RF headset used in conference simultaneous translation settings). Are there such RF transmitters using 76-108 MHz frequences which could be connected to USB ports?
